The Olympics Men's Team Table Tennis playoff began Friday.


In the team tournament 16 teams square off against each other, with the Chinese medal winners anchoring their country's team, and Mizutani on the Japan team. There is no Belarus team in the competition, but they have a solid cornerstone for future development.

Featured is Ukrainian born Dimitrij Ovtcharov, who plays for the German national team. His team squares off today against Taiwan.
